Adjust Load Settings Precisely
My first success was when I measured my typical laundry load and manually adjusted the water level accordingly. Instead of relying on the default, I set the water to match only what was necessary. This prevented overfilling and saved a significant amount of water each week. To do this, consult your machine’s manual or settings menu to find the load size adjustment options. Remember, a smaller load requires less water—think of it as watering only what your plants need rather than the entire garden. This simple tweak immediately lowered my water bill and extended the life of my appliance.
Optimize Cycle Selection
Modern washers come with various cycles—eco, quick, heavy-duty—that manage water use differently. I once mistakenly used the heavy-duty cycle for a small load of lightly soiled shirts, wasting water. Switching to the eco-mode tailored for lighter loads cut water consumption significantly. When choosing a cycle, check if your machine offers a water-saving option. Many smart models automatically adjust water levels based on detected load size. Experimenting with these modes—like switching from a standard to an eco-cycle—can slash water use without sacrificing cleaning power.

Practice Routine Maintenance for Peak Efficiency
Occasionally, I cleaned the lint filters and checked for obstructions, which maintained optimal water flow. Sediment buildup or clogged filters can cause your washer to overuse water trying to compensate for poor drainage. Regularly inspecting and cleaning these parts is like tuning a car engine—they run more efficiently and use less resource. If your cycles seem to require longer times or water levels appear higher than normal, consider a deep clean or recalibration. Investing a few minutes here keeps your machine running at peak water-saving performance.

Why do some smart appliances seem to use more power over time, despite their advanced features?
Power consumption can increase due to several factors, including sensor drift and firmware issues that cause devices to run cycles longer than necessary. Regularly inspecting your appliances for firmware updates and sensor accuracy can significantly reduce waste. For instance, issues with a smart washer’s drum balance sensor can lead it to wash at higher water levels unnecessarily, which can be a costly mistake if ignored. Avoid the trap of assuming these devices will self-correct without user oversight. Maintaining proper calibration, cleaning sensors, and reviewing energy reports can help you optimize their performance.
